Understanding House Edge in Online Casinos

What Is House Edge?

House edge represents the mathematical advantage casinos maintain over players in any given game. It’s the percentage of each bet that the casino expects to win over time. Understanding this concept is crucial for anyone interested in online gambling.

Why It Matters

Every casino game, whether it’s slots, blackjack, or roulette, has a built-in house edge. This isn’t cheating—it’s how casinos generate revenue. For example, European roulette has a 2.7% house edge, while American roulette sits at 5.26%.

Comparing Different Games

Different games offer varying advantages to the casino. Table games like blackjack typically feature lower house edges (0.5-1%), making them potentially more favorable for players. Slots usually have higher edges, ranging from 2-15% depending on the game and provider.
